7_«µBS  Main Link, argument is `z`
7_      Evaluate `7 - z`
  «     Take the minimum of that and `z` itself
    µ    Start a new monadic chain (to prevent the `B` atom from affecting the minimum)
    B   Binary digits
     S  Sum

Chopsticks is a hand game for two players, in which players extend a number of fingers from each hand and transfer those scores by taking turns to tap one hand against another. Chopsticks is an example of a combinatorial game, and is solved in the sense that with perfect play an optimal strategy from any point is known. == Rules == Each player uses both hands to play the game, the number of digits extended on a hand showing the number of points that the hand has. Both start with each hand having one point — one finger extended on each hand. The goal of the game is for a player to force th...
